当前位置:首页 > DressCode – 上海科技大学推出的3D服装生成框架
DressCode – 上海科技大学推出的3D服装生成框架
作者:AI下载 发布时间:2025-02-20

DressCode是什么

DressCode是上海科技大学、宾夕法尼亚大学和Deemos科技联合推出的3D服装生成框架。支持用户通过文本描述来自动生成各种风格和材质的3D服装模型。基于SewingGPT核心模块,DressCode能理解文本提示并转化为精细的裁剪图案,再结合物理基础的渲染技术,创造出逼真的服装效果。

DressCode

DressCode的主要功能

文本驱动的服装生成:用户输入文本描述,系统自动生成相应的3D服装模型。材料和纹理模拟:根据文本提示生成不同材质,如丝绸、蕾丝,并模拟真实光照效果。语义理解与图案生成:SewingGPT模块解析文本,生成裁剪图案tokens序列。物理基础渲染:高级布料动力学算法,模拟真实服装的垂坠和动态效果。

DressCode的技术原理

自然语言处理(NLP):DressCode使用先进的NLP技术来解析和理解用户的文本输入,捕捉服装描述中的关键特征和风格要求。序列生成模型:SewingGPT作为核心组件,采用基于Transformer的解码器架构,将文本描述转化为服装裁剪图案的序列化表示(tokens序列)。量化与反量化:服装图案的参数通过量化过程转换成tokens,生成过程后再进行反量化,在3D空间中重建图案。条件生成:利用文本条件嵌入和交叉注意力机制,SewingGPT能够根据文本提示生成符合描述的服装图案。物理基础渲染(PBR):DressCode采用PBR技术为服装生成逼真的纹理和材质效果,模拟不同面料在光照下的反射和折射特性。布料动力学模拟:集成高级布料模拟算法,确保服装在虚拟环境中表现出真实的物理行为,如褶皱、摆动等。DressCode

DressCode的项目地址

项目官网:https://ailb-web.ing.unimore.it/dress-code/dataset